DESPITE ALL FEARS, GOD HAS THE FINAL SAY

Post date: May 3, 2020 10:49:30 PM

“What shall we say about such wonderful things as these? If God is for us, who can ever be against us? Since He did not spare even His own Son but gave Him up for us all, won’t He also give us everything else? Who dares accuse us whom God has chosen for His own? No one, for God Himself has given us right standing with Himself. Who then will condemn us? No one, for Christ Jesus died for us and was raised to life for us, and He is sitting in the place of honor at God’s right hand pleading for us. Can anything ever separate us from Christ’s love? Does it mean He no longer loves us if we have trouble or calamity, or are persecuted, or hungry, or destitute, or in danger, or threatened with death? As the Scriptures say, for your sake we are killed every day; we are being slaughtered like sheep. No, despite all these things, overwhelming victory is ours through Christ, who loved us. And I am convinced that nothing can ever separate us from God’s love. Neither death nor life, neither angels nor demons, neither our fears for today nor our worries about tomorrow, not even the powers of hell can separate us from God’s love. No power in the sky above or in the earth below, indeed, nothing in all creation will ever be able to separate us from the love of God that is revealed in Christ Jesus our Lord.” Romans 8:31-39

Many things are constantly challenging us and will continue to challenge us, but despite all of the challenges, God has the final say concerning your life. Many people will stand to challenge and frustrate you, but despite their challenges, God has the final say concerning your life despite the challenges and frustrations. Many people will ask you simple and sometimes very difficult questions that you will not be able to give adequate and satisfying answers, but despite all the hard or simple questions, God has the final say concerning you. He will speak again concerning you; He will comfort you with His provisions; He will direct you with His words; He will protect you in difficult times; He will heal your body and give health; He will deliver you and protect you by His power. In all things, He is able and willing, and He is faithful; He will not fail you and He will not forsake you. Believe Him and follow Him and be committed to His work.

God is true, God is supernatural, God is real, God is alive, God is love, and He is God who keeps all of His words and promises to His children. None of His words will fail, none of His promises will go unfulfilled because He is always faithful to His words. When God speaks, His words are true and powerful that things begin happening. When He says you will live, you will live; when He says you are blessed, you will be blessed; when He said you should increase, you will surely increase; when He says you are above, you will be above. In all things, in all nations, and in all situations, God has the final say and His verdicts concerning you will be fulfilled irrespective of the prevailing situation and your location. It will happen despite the challenges and whatever the devil will ever do or say against you in that situation.

God does not require explanations in His actions, the only explanation we will have is that we serve the God who is powerful and can do all things. Doctors will not be able to explain your healing when God says you are healed; science and scientist will not be able to explain your breakthrough when God opens the doors for you; the financial experts will not be able to explain your financial blessing when God declares it. Your family members will not be able to explain what you will become when God blesses you.

When God blessed Jabez, he was blessed beyond any kind of sophisticated explanation. All the explanation given was that Jabez prayed and God answered and granted his prayers. “There was a man named Jabez who was more honorable than any of his brothers. His mother named him Jabez because his birth had been so painful. He was the one who prayed to the God of Israel, Oh, that you would bless me and expand my territory.
